    The movie about the Debarge musical family is looking for new faces for upcoming scenes. This Atlanta casting call will be held near Midtown on Friday, May 31, 2019.

    The Bobby Debarge movie chronicles the quick rise of the mulatto Debarge family, which took soul music by storm in the early 1980s. Drug abuse, physical violence and the rough-and-tumble music business took its toll on the clan.

    Now, a movie is going to give audiences a look behind the velvet rope.

    Atlanta has become a movie mecca in recent years and Georgia has been a favorite location for TV productions since the state instituted generous tax breaks for film companies that agree to shoot locally. Projects from CBS, NBC, HBO, BET and more are slated to shoot in the metro area in 2018-19 and the foreseeable future.

    With more than 700 movie and TV projects just in the last few years, the film industry has generated more than $9 billion for the state of Georgia.
